The Future of Work Is Already Here
Not long ago, flexible work was a perk. Today it's an expectation. As remote and hybrid models become the norm, companies of every size face the same question: how do we adapt without losing performance, culture or profitability?
The new rules
The traditional office is being redefined. People now expect flexibility, autonomy and purpose, not only a paycheck. That freedom brings real complexity:
- How do you maintain productivity across time zones?
- How do you build culture without the hallway conversations?
- How do you track performance without micromanaging?
- How do you hire and keep good people from anywhere?
These are not only human resources questions. They determine whether a company grows or stalls.
